Abstract
This paper considers the network design and control for multipoint-to-multi point communications. We propose a new routing control method which include s the member connection method and the route setup algorithm. The former im plies that each member has its own route to send information to other membe rs. Thus, it can avoid traffic concentration in a particular route. Further , in the route setup algorithm, all routes are generated in parallel, by ad ding links which have lower cost and lower load one by one, based on groupi ng by the number of destination nodes on the route. An interesting feature of the proposed algorithm is that every route can be established with a uni fied algorithm, even when newcomers join ongoing communications. In additio n to the above method, we also propose a network design algorithm. It can m ake the proposed routing control method more effective. Simulation experime nts show that the proposed framework is suitable for multipoint-to-multipoi nt communications. (C) 2000 Scripta Technica.
